Descripción del empleo

  • Plan, implement, evaluate, and complete execution of assigned laboratory clinical trials/projects; may function as a global lead, where applicable. Expected to manage medium to high complexity trials.
  • Set goals and timelines, provide oversight and foster motivation within the team to accomplish goals within defined timelines and with high quality in the execution of assigned laboratory clinical trials/projects
  • Provide oversight and coordination of the operational aspects of the functional areas on assigned clinical trials/projects to ensure compliance with International Council for Harmonization (ICH) guidelines, Good Clinical Practices (GCP), applicable regulatory guidelines, and laboratory procedures
  • Provide management of the full scope of laboratory clinical trials/projects including global clinical trials/projects from start-up through closeout; provide oversight of functionally assigned teams members on laboratory clinical trials/projects; manage multiple clinical trials/projects simultaneously
  • Work closely with the CTI Clinical Project Manager and Team members on full service clinical trials/projects
  • Provide coordination of a laboratory clinical trial/project including organization, implementation, and management of scoped activities
  • Prepare or provide oversight to the development of project plans and timelines; work with laboratory leadership and/or line manager to provide effective solutions to challenges that arise during the laboratory clinical trial/project
  • Participate in or provide oversight and guidance in the development of clinical trial/project required deliverables
  • Serve as Global Project Manager and/or client contact at clinical trial/project operational level
  • Provide oversight to contracted vendors; review contracted specifications and maintains regular interactions with vendors to ensure meeting timelines and expectations
  • Provide oversight of appropriate clinical trial/project tracking using computer-assisted programs and ensure timely entry of project information by all project team members to enable accurate reporting to clients and CTI executive management
  • Monitor ongoing resource needs to the clinical trial/project; keep appropriate functional department heads apprised of any identified resource needs or performance issues
  • Ensure that assigned clinical trial/project team receives appropriate training as needed to facilitate effective implementation, conduct and execution of the clinical trial/project
  • In conjunction with the client and cross‑functional CTI laboratory departments, create the Laboratory Specifications Plan based upon contracted services at the initiation of a new clinical trial/project, and maintain and update the document as needed throughout the lifecycle of the clinical trial/project
  • Build clinical trial/project‑specific laboratory database in lab information management system (LIMS) at initiation of a new clinical trial/project; maintain and update the database as needed throughout the lifecycle of the clinical trial/project.
  • Develop project‑specific site tools such as the Laboratory Manual and Quick Reference Guides (if applicable); maintain and update these documents as applicable throughout the lifecycle of the clinical trial/project
  • Work with cross‑functional CTI laboratory departments to design clinical trial/project‑specific tools and supplies such as sample requisition forms, sample labels, and lab kits
  • Serve as liaison between logistics and data management to resolve issues with samples
  • Implement project activities according to scope of contracted work
  • Coordinate shipment of stored samples as directed by the scope of work and supporting documents, in conjunction with the client
  • Evaluate and manage clinical trial/project budget against project milestones and scope; work with laboratory leadership to take corrective measures where necessary to keep clinical trial/project in line with budget
  • Assess scope of work against client contractual agreements and works with laboratory leadership to facilitate change of scope orders when appropriate
  • Lead client and team meetings to enable effective information sharing, discussion and decision‑making; ensures accurate and complete documentation of the meeting discussions, decisions and outcomes
  • Prepare or provide oversight/approval of weekly and/or monthly clinical trial/project status reports for assigned projects
  • Participate and contribute to site training meetings, such as Investigator meetings or site initiation visits
  • Suggest and participate in process improvement activities and initiatives
